The Nationwide Foundation, Ohio Farm Bureau, and The Ohio State University College of Food, Agricultural, and Environmental Sciences are collaborating through the Nationwide AgTech Innovation Hub to provide a third round of funding opportunities for CFAES faculty. This initiative seeks applied, solution-driven research projects that help the agricultural community understand, manage, and mitigate climate risk. Approximately 3–5 projects will be funded, with awards up to $100,000 for an 11-month project period, starting Feb.1, 2026 – Dec. 31, 2026.
